Windows 10 Insiders were given an evening treat last night when Dona Sarkar and the Windows 10 Insider team pushed out build 14986 to insiders in the Fast Ring. While the build brought a plethora of new features, it also delivered some major improvements to the game bar and the ability to go full screen with more games on Windows 10.

According to Dona Sarkar, this latest build adds support for 19 games in full-screen mode. Games such as ARMA 3, Battlefield 1, Dark Souls III, Fallout 4, Final Fantasy XIV: A Realm Reborn, and Overwatch all now have support for full-screen mode. Other games include:

  • Civilization V
  • Mad Max
  • Mafia 2
  • NBA 2K16
  • Star Wars: The Old Republic
  • StarCraft II: Heart of the Swarm
  • The Binding of Isaac
  • The Witcher 3: Wild Hunt
  • Terraria
  • Tom Clancy’s The Division
  • Total War: WARHAMMER
  • Warframe
  • World of Tanks

The full-screen feature can be controlled through the Windows 10 Game Bar, which is accessed by pressing Windows Key and G. After pressing the keys, in the settings dialog, look for the “Show Game bar when I play full-screen games” checkbox. According to Major Nelson, With this setting activated, Game DVR only runs when you activate it and has no performance impact on your games.
